Bobby Cannavale is an American actor known for his dynamic performances across television, film, and stage. He was born on May 3, 1970, in Union City, New Jersey, and raised in a working-class family. Cannavale developed an early interest in acting and began performing in theater before moving into television roles in the late 1990s.
He first gained recognition for his role as Bobby Caffey on the NBC series Third Watch. His breakthrough came with HBO’s Boardwalk Empire (2012), where he portrayed the volatile gangster Gyp Rosetti, earning a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Supporting Actor. Cannavale further showcased his range with roles in Vinyl and Mr. Robot, where his portrayal of Irving received critical praise.
In film, he has appeared in projects such as Blue Jasmine, Ant-Man, and The Irishman. Known for his commanding screen presence and versatility, Cannavale has also maintained a strong connection to theater, performing in Broadway productions.
With his ability to bring intensity and authenticity to diverse roles, Bobby Cannavale has established himself as one of the most respected character actors of his generation.
